Dubai-based logistics firm DP World is eyeing significant investments in the Philippines, including the establishment of a logistics hub and an industrial park.
The potential investment was discussed during a meeting between Department of Trade and Industry (DTI) Secretary Alfredo Pascual and DP World executives in Abu Dhabi.
Pascual expressed optimism about collaborating with DP World to enhance the Philippines' logistics sector through industrial parks, economic zones, and digital solutions.
The DTI chief emphasized the government's commitment to creating policies that support sustainable development, foreign investment, and innovation within the logistics industry.
DP World's planned investments align with the Philippines' ambition to become a leading logistics hub in Asia.
